In this paper, the ZnO/Cu2S/ZnO complex films were fabricated by Radio Frequency (RF) magnetron sputtering, and their transparent, conductive and photocatalytic properties have been investigated. The results show the properties of ZnO/Cu2S/ZnO complex films vary when the top layer ZnO thickness changes.
The V2O5films were prepared by the (radio frequency)RF sputtering. The transmission of the samples under different deposition pressures and different Ar/O2flow ratios was investigated to determine the fundamental preparation condition for the further analysis. On the fundamental condition, the security volt of V2O5was determined. It is concluded that the annealing makes the V2O5films have a good reversibility but lowers the electrochromic property.
